sslug-teknik team mailing list archive
-
sslug-teknik team
-
Mailing list archive
-
Message #19671
Re: Bare fordi man roder lidt..kører man helt fast.
Hej!
Beklager de mange mails om samme emne;
(Hvordan man starter en linux med 1 ok samt 1 "inkonsistent" HD)
men jeg er ikke helt sluppet igennem endnu:
Først prøvede jeg at:
mkdir /mnt/hdc1
mkdir /mnt/hdc5
mount -t ext2 /dev/hdc1 /mnt/hdc1
mount -t ext2 /dev/hdc5 /mnt/hdc5
hvis det virker kan du indføre passende linier i /etc/fstab
..Det ville linux godt være med til.
..Jeg tilføjede derefter 4 enties i /etc/fstab, nemlig for
..hdc1, hdc2, hdc5 og hdc6. Ved efterfølgende boot, forsøger den at
..få fat på /dev/hdc5. Jeg ser:
/dev/hda5: clean, 75229/513024 files, 329609/1024135 blocks
/dev/hdc5: ========== osv.=== check...
Unattached inode 193154
/dev/hdc5: UNEXPECTED INCONSISTENCY; RUN fsck MANUALLY.
(i.e., without -a or -p options)
fsck.ext2(null):
The superblock could not be read or does not describe a correct ext2
filesystem. If the device is valid and if it really contains an ext2
filesystem (and not swap or ufs or something else), then the superblock
is corrupt, and you might try running e2fsck with an alternate superblock:
e2fsck -b 8193 (device)
:Bad magic number in superblock while trying to open /dev/hdc6 [FAILED]
*** An error occurred during the file system-check.
*** Dropping you to e shell; the system will reboot
*** when you leave the shell.
Give root password for maintenance
(or type Control D for normal startup):
..jeg prøver at følge rådet og taster:
e2fsck -b 8193 /dev/hdc5
..men får samme fejlmeddelse igen
.. jeg exiter/rebooter og ved næste startup får jeg fejlen:
Warning...fsck.ext2 for device /dev/hdc5 exited with a signal 10 [FAILED]
*** An error occurred during the file system-check.
*** Dropping you to e shell; the system will reboot
*** when you leave the shell.
Give root password for maintenance
(or type Control D for normal startup):
..Jeg prøver maintenance-shellen, og overvejer at starte mc eller pico for at rette
fstab tilbage, men kan ikke finde nogen editor. "man" virker heller ikke.
Så prøver jeg "fsck /dev/hdc5", og den gennemfører faktisk sit job;
men ved efterfølgende boot bemærker jeg:
/dev/hda1 clean, 25/4016 files 3148/16033 blocks, ;efter denne linie står der nu:
Could this be a Zero-length partition? ; det har jeg ikke lagt mærke til tidligere
fsck.ext2: Attempt to read block from filesystem resulted in short read while
trying to read /dev/hdc2
/dev/hdc5 clean 51169/515072 files 198877/1028152 blocks
/dev/hda8 clean 11/513824 files 16117/1024135 blocks
(null):
The superblock could not be read or does not describe a correct ext2
filesystem. If the device is valid and if it really contains an ext2
filesystem (and not swap or ufs or something else), then the superblock
is corrupt, and you might try running e2fsck with an alternate superblock:
e2fsck -b 8193 (device)
/dev/hda6 clean 2626/51324 files 20328/1024135 blocks
fsck.ext2: Bad magic number in superblock while trying to open /dev/hdc6
/dev/hda11 clean 11/238080 files 7487/475917 blocks
/dev/hda9 clean 50/128520 files 16288/514048 blocks
/dev/hda5 clean 75229/513024 files 329609/1024135 blocks
[FAILED]
*** An error occurred during the file system-check.
*** Dropping you to e shell; the system will reboot
*** when you leave the shell.
Give root password for maintenance
(or type Control D for normal startup):
..med andre ord /dev/hdc6 har det ikke så godt.
..Jeg vælger maintenance og "fsck /dev/hdc6";
..men intet hjælper. Jeg får hele tiden en af de to fejlmeddelelser:
.."fsck.ext2: Bad magic number in superblock while.." - eller
.."The superblock could not be read or does not describe a correct ext2.."
Til sidst bliver jeg enig med mig selv om, at jeg muligvis må have
skrevet noget giftigt i /ect/fstab, og piller hdc-harddisken fysisk
ud af PC'en, i håb om at linux vil ignorer drevet, når den ikke finder
den fysiske harddisk. Dette vil atter gøre det muligt at boote på hda,
sådan at jeg (midlertidigt) kan fjerne de linier jeg tilføjede i fstab.
Men ak, ikke en gang det vil linux være med til (den VIL ha hdc med nu).
Har den shell jeg kommer ud i ikke en editor, er jeg muligvis på
spanden. Lige nu er jeg ihvertfald løbet tør for ideer.
Boot fra Rescue-floppy giver heller intet resultat
Måske burde jeg manuelt have oprettet de biblioteker jeg nævnte min fstab?
Kan jeg komme videre på nogen måde, så jeg kan boote linux op igen,
eller er det "bare helt forfra" med RedHat 6.1?
Uden man sider/editor er det ihvertfald svært.
..gode tip etc...
Venlig hilsen Odder
On Sat, 04 Mar 2000 22:27:01 +0100, MONZ wrote:
>Odder wrote:
>> Hvis jeg fra root taster "ls -al /dev/hdc" får jeg svaret:
>> brw-rw---- 1 root disk 22 0 May 5 1998 /dev/hdc
>>
>> - om det er godt eller skidt ved jeg ikke...
>
>Det _er_ godt!
>
>> hvis jeg taster "fdisk -l /dev/hdc" får jeg svaret:
>> Disk /dev/hdc: 255 heads, 63 sectors, 524 cylinders
>> Units = cylinders of 16065 * 512 bytes
>> Device Boot Start End Blocks Id System
>> /dev/hdc1 * 1 3 24066 83 Linux
>> /dev/hdc2 4 524 4184932+ 5 Extended
>> /dev/hdc5 4 515 4112608+ 83 Linux
>> /dev/hdc6 516 524 72261 82 linux swap
>>
>> hvis jeg taster "mount /dev/hdc" får jeg svaret:
>> mount: can't find /dev/hdc in /etc/fstab or /etc/mtab
>>
>> - og det er jo mest trist. Jeg har View'et indholdet af /dev/hdc
>> samt /etc/mtab. Og det er rigtig nok. hdc står ikke nævnt noget sted.
>
>Så indsæt et entry for den i /etc/fstab li'som for fx. /dev/hda .
>--
>Mogens Valentin - mailto:monz@xxxxxxxxx - WWW: http://www.danbbs.dk/~monz/
>Web, Programming, Network, Security - Guides for Linux, Xwindow and more..
>Skaane/Sjaelland Linux User Group (4800++ members!) - http://www.sslug.dk/
>Get a grip, get http://www.linux.org/, freedom of choice and free software
>
Follow ups